238 /*
239 * Help for all debugger commands. First argument is the number of lines
240 * of help to output for the command.
241 */
242 static const ACPI_DB_COMMAND_HELP AcpiGbl_DbCommandHelp[] =
243 {
244 {0, "\nGeneral-Purpose Commands:", "\n"},
245 {1, " Allocations", "Display list of current memory allocations\n"},
246 {2, " Dump <Address>|<Namepath>", "\n"},
247 {0, " [Byte|Word|Dword|Qword]", "Display ACPI objects or memory\n"},
248 {1, " Handlers", "Info about global handlers\n"},
249 {1, " Help [Command]", "This help screen or individual command\n"},
250 {1, " History", "Display command history buffer\n"},
251 {1, " Level <DebugLevel>] [console]", "Get/Set debug level for file or console\n"},
252 {1, " Locks", "Current status of internal mutexes\n"},
253 {1, " Osi [Install|Remove <name>]", "Display or modify global _OSI list\n"},
254 {1, " Quit or Exit", "Exit this command\n"},
255 {8, " Stats <SubCommand>", "Display namespace and memory statistics\n"},
256 {1, " Allocations", "Display list of current memory allocations\n"},
257 {1, " Memory", "Dump internal memory lists\n"},
258 {1, " Misc", "Namespace search and mutex stats\n"},
259 {1, " Objects", "Summary of namespace objects\n"},
260 {1, " Sizes", "Sizes for each of the internal objects\n"},
261 {1, " Stack", "Display CPU stack usage\n"},
262 {1, " Tables", "Info about current ACPI table(s)\n"},
263 {1, " Tables", "Display info about loaded ACPI tables\n"},
264 {1, " ! <CommandNumber>", "Execute command from history buffer\n"},
265 {1, " !!", "Execute last command again\n"},
266
267 {0, "\nNamespace Access Commands:", "\n"},
268 {1, " Businfo", "Display system bus info\n"},
269 {1, " Disassemble <Method>", "Disassemble a control method\n"},
270 {1, " Find <AcpiName> (? is wildcard)", "Find ACPI name(s) with wildcards\n"},
271 {1, " Integrity", "Validate namespace integrity\n"},
272 {1, " Methods", "Display list of loaded control methods\n"},
273 {1, " Namespace [Object] [Depth]", "Display loaded namespace tree/subtree\n"},
274 {1, " Notify <Object> <Value>", "Send a notification on Object\n"},
275 {1, " Objects [ObjectType]", "Display summary of all objects or just given type\n"},
276 {1, " Owner <OwnerId> [Depth]", "Display loaded namespace by object owner\n"},
277 {1, " Paths", "Display full pathnames of namespace objects\n"},
278 {1, " Predefined", "Check all predefined names\n"},
279 {1, " Prefix [<Namepath>]", "Set or Get current execution prefix\n"},
280 {1, " References <Addr>", "Find all references to object at addr\n"},
281 {1, " Resources [DeviceName]", "Display Device resources (no arg = all devices)\n"},
282 {1, " Set N <NamedObject> <Value>", "Set value for named integer\n"},
283 {1, " Template <Object>", "Format/dump a Buffer/ResourceTemplate\n"},
284 {1, " Type <Object>", "Display object type\n"},
285
286 {0, "\nControl Method Execution Commands:","\n"},
287 {1, " Arguments (or Args)", "Display method arguments\n"},
288 {1, " Breakpoint <AmlOffset>", "Set an AML execution breakpoint\n"},
289 {1, " Call", "Run to next control method invocation\n"},
290 {1, " Debug <Namepath> [Arguments]", "Single Step a control method\n"},
291 {6, " Evaluate", "Synonym for Execute\n"},
292 {5, " Execute <Namepath> [Arguments]", "Execute control method\n"},
293 {1, " Hex Integer", "Integer method argument\n"},
294 {1, " \"Ascii String\"", "String method argument\n"},
295 {1, " (Hex Byte List)", "Buffer method argument\n"},
296 {1, " [Package Element List]", "Package method argument\n"},
297 {5, " Execute predefined", "Execute all predefined (public) methods\n"},
298 {1, " Go", "Allow method to run to completion\n"},
299 {1, " Information", "Display info about the current method\n"},
300 {1, " Into", "Step into (not over) a method call\n"},
301 {1, " List [# of Aml Opcodes]", "Display method ASL statements\n"},
302 {1, " Locals", "Display method local variables\n"},
303 {1, " Results", "Display method result stack\n"},
304 {1, " Set <A|L> <#> <Value>", "Set method data (Arguments/Locals)\n"},
305 {1, " Stop", "Terminate control method\n"},
306 {5, " Trace <State> [<Namepath>] [Once]", "Trace control method execution\n"},
307 {1, " Enable", "Enable all messages\n"},
308 {1, " Disable", "Disable tracing\n"},
309 {1, " Method", "Enable method execution messages\n"},
310 {1, " Opcode", "Enable opcode execution messages\n"},
311 {1, " Tree", "Display control method calling tree\n"},
312 {1, " <Enter>", "Single step next AML opcode (over calls)\n"},
313
314 #ifdef ACPI_APPLICATION
315 {0, "\nHardware Simulation Commands:", "\n"},
316 {1, " EnableAcpi", "Enable ACPI (hardware) mode\n"},
317 {1, " Event <F|G> <Value>", "Generate AcpiEvent (Fixed/GPE)\n"},
318 {1, " Gpe <GpeNum> [GpeBlockDevice]", "Simulate a GPE\n"},
319 {1, " Gpes", "Display info on all GPE devices\n"},
320 {1, " Sci", "Generate an SCI\n"},
321 {1, " Sleep [SleepState]", "Simulate sleep/wake sequence(s) (0-5)\n"},
322
323 {0, "\nFile I/O Commands:", "\n"},
324 {1, " Close", "Close debug output file\n"},
325 {1, " Load <Input Filename>", "Load ACPI table from a file\n"},
326 {1, " Open <Output Filename>", "Open a file for debug output\n"},
327 {1, " Unload <Namepath>", "Unload an ACPI table via namespace object\n"},
328
329 {0, "\nUser Space Commands:", "\n"},
330 {1, " Terminate", "Delete namespace and all internal objects\n"},
331 {1, " Thread <Threads><Loops><NamePath>", "Spawn threads to execute method(s)\n"},
332
333 {0, "\nDebug Test Commands:", "\n"},
334 {3, " Test <TestName>", "Invoke a debug test\n"},
335 {1, " Objects", "Read/write/compare all namespace data objects\n"},
336 {1, " Predefined", "Execute all ACPI predefined names (_STA, etc.)\n"},
337 #endif
338 {0, NULL, NULL}
339 };

481 /*******************************************************************************
482 *
483 * FUNCTION: AcpiDbGetNextToken
484 *
485 * PARAMETERS: String - Command buffer
486 * Next - Return value, end of next token
487 *
488 * RETURN: Pointer to the start of the next token.
489 *
490 * DESCRIPTION: Command line parsing. Get the next token on the command line
491 *
492 ******************************************************************************/
493
494 char *
495 AcpiDbGetNextToken (
496 char *String,
497 char **Next,
498 ACPI_OBJECT_TYPE *ReturnType)
499 {
500 char *Start;
501 UINT32 Depth;
502 ACPI_OBJECT_TYPE Type = ACPI_TYPE_INTEGER;
503
504
505 /* At end of buffer? */
506
507 if (!String || !(*String))
508 {
509 return (NULL);
510 }
511
512 /* Remove any spaces at the beginning */
513
514 if (*String == ' ')
515 {
516 while (*String && (*String == ' '))
517 {
518 String++;
519 }
520
521 if (!(*String))
522 {
523 return (NULL);
524 }
525 }
526
527 switch (*String)
528 {
529 case '"':
530
531 /* This is a quoted string, scan until closing quote */
532
533 String++;
534 Start = String;
535 Type = ACPI_TYPE_STRING;
536
537 /* Find end of string */
538
539 while (*String && (*String != '"'))
540 {
541 String++;
542 }
543 break;
544
545 case '(':
546
547 /* This is the start of a buffer, scan until closing paren */
548
549 String++;
550 Start = String;
551 Type = ACPI_TYPE_BUFFER;
552
553 /* Find end of buffer */
554
555 while (*String && (*String != ')'))
556 {
557 String++;
558 }
559 break;
560
561 case '[':
562
563 /* This is the start of a package, scan until closing bracket */
564
565 String++;
566 Depth = 1;
567 Start = String;
568 Type = ACPI_TYPE_PACKAGE;
569
570 /* Find end of package (closing bracket) */
571
572 while (*String)
573 {
574 /* Handle String package elements */
575
576 if (*String == '"')
577 {
578 /* Find end of string */
579
580 String++;
581 while (*String && (*String != '"'))
582 {
583 String++;
584 }
585 if (!(*String))
586 {
587 break;
588 }
589 }
590 else if (*String == '[')
591 {
592 Depth++; /* A nested package declaration */
593 }
594 else if (*String == ']')
595 {
596 Depth--;
597 if (Depth == 0) /* Found final package closing bracket */
598 {
599 break;
600 }
601 }
602
603 String++;
604 }
605 break;
606
607 default:
608
609 Start = String;
610
611 /* Find end of token */
612
613 while (*String && (*String != ' '))
614 {
615 String++;
616 }
617 break;
618 }
619
620 if (!(*String))
621 {
622 *Next = NULL;
623 }
624 else
625 {
626 *String = 0;
627 *Next = String + 1;
628 }
629
630 *ReturnType = Type;
631 return (Start);
632 }
